diff options
author | Jimmy Hu <jim2212001@gmail.com> | 2018-09-22 16:21:22 +0800 |
---|---|---|
committer | Jimmy Hu <jim2212001@gmail.com> | 2018-09-22 20:33:59 +0800 |
commit | a6d13780f138b33169c748b25a41f7d94ab620ee (patch) | |
tree | 8c36daba3c668427036acd9f5feef83b88f95718 /.travis.yml | |
parent | 1c36a87da5bbc1cd6dc0e9d9c0e5fbf2e4640dad (diff) | |
download | d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.tar d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.tar.gz d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.tar.bz2 d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.tar.lz d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.tar.xz d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.tar.zst dexon-bls-a6d13780f138b33169c748b25a41f7d94ab620ee.zip |
Modify build script.
Diffstat (limited to '.travis.yml')
-rw-r--r-- | .travis.yml | 15 |
1 files changed, 8 insertions, 7 deletions
diff --git a/.travis.yml b/.travis.yml index 81fa0eb..403c433 100644 --- a/.travis.yml +++ b/.travis.yml @@ -1,16 +1,17 @@ -sudo: required +sudo: false dist: trusty language: cpp compiler: - gcc - clang -before_install: - - sudo apt install -y libgmp-dev +addons: + apt: + packages: + - libgmp-dev +install: + - git clone --depth 1 https://github.com/herumi/mcl.git $TRAVIS_BUILD_DIR/../mcl script: - - git clone --depth 1 https://github.com/herumi/mcl.git - - git clone --depth 1 https://github.com/herumi/bls.git - - cd bls - - make + - make -j3 - make test DISABLE_THREAD_TEST=1 - make test_go - bin/bls_c384_test.exe |